A 22-page notification was issued by the Department of Expenditure, Ministry of Finance, on October 29, 2021. It was titled “General Instructions on Procurement and Project Management”, which is an innocuous one. There was no announcement on this by the prime minister or finance minister. Very few in the media and business circles even took notice of this. All Central government entities were routinely informed, and the document was quietly hosted on the ministry website.
